Getting into the hardware lab at Quillford Point is pretty simple, but don't just wander in. The lab (room 2.14, past the Tindersley kitchenette) needs a booking in the Lattice calendar first. Closed-toe shoes required, no drinks near the benches — Marголd on the lab team will absolutely notice. Assistants escorting guests should sign them in at the door tablet. Once your booking is confirmed, enter using the door code below.

door code, yagap-bahof: bdg-O-05

## Recovery: Transcode Farm Admin

If the Fernwheel transcoding farm locks out the admin account (usually after a bad cert rotation), don't panic — jobs keep draining for about an hour. Hop on the bastion, run the reset tool, and it'll prompt you. When it asks for the recovery passphrase, enter the one printed below.

recovery phrase for bawef-haduf: wenax-druox-julmir

## Formula sandbox tuning

User-supplied formulas in Gridmoor execute inside a restricted interpreter with hard ceilings on time, memory, and call depth. Reviewers should confirm any change to these ceilings is justified in the PR description, since raising them widens the abuse surface. Defaults were chosen from production traces. The current limits are as follows.

limits module of tafog-fawip:
WEIGHTS = {
    "julix": 57,
    "lamys": 992,
    "kasvan": 209,
    "quenok": 750,
    "alddor": 259,
    "oliath": 1009,
    "wenix": 815,
}

Hello plugin authors,

As of last night, all user-supplied formulas on Calcwright now execute inside the new Quarrel sandbox. Legacy eval paths are disabled; plugins relying on direct interpreter access will fail validation until updated. Execution limits are enforced per invocation, and filesystem or network calls from formulas are blocked outright. Most plugins passed our compatibility sweep without changes. Before resubmitting, verify your plugin against the sandbox defaults. The current production configuration values are listed below.

config for kafof-bawef:
holath:
  log_level: debug
  metrics_host: metrics.holath.qorvelsys.internal
  pin: 2191
  pool_size: 32